Getting perspective

Writers: Ang, Miriah
Date Posted: 27th March 2014

Characters: Paetri, D'ret
Description: A discussion between friends on where to go from here
Location: Dragonsfall Weyr
Date: month 6, day 15 of Turn 7
Notes: Mentioned: J'kri


The flight was more of an eye-opener than he'd realized and it was time to
talk to someone about it. ** Can you ask Camilth if Paetri is available? **

Petrith yawned and asked }: Camilth, mine would like to see yours. Can he
come over? :{

Camilth answered promptly. }: Mine says you and yours always welcome.:{
There was a pause. }: As long as he is clothed.:{ There was another pause.
}: He's not naked is he? Because I think it would be kind of funny. We're
in our weyr.:{

D'ret stopped and stared as Petrith blinked quickly ** What? **

}: She said you cannot go naked. But Camilth thought it would be funny :{
She regarded her sister's words thoughtfully before shaking her head. }:
Mine will not be naked. He does not like Yours that way :{ she bespoke
them both which had D'ret rolling his eyes.

It was a good thing they were close, the walk wasn't long. Plastering a
smile on his face, he opened the door and called out, "I promise I'm not
naked!"

}: I know that. But Mine thinks yours would do it just to see her turn
funny colors. :{ Camilth replied promptly.

Paetri's weyr was one of the smallest, but it was cozy and had light
feminine touches in the decorations. Looking up from the couch, Paetri put
aside her tattered hide that she was writing on and offered a wry grin as
she gestured him in. "With you, I can never be sure. Come on in. I have
some juice if you want any."

He moved right to the juice and poured a healthy amount. D'ret took a large
swallow before he sat down next to her. With a loud sigh and soft belch,
he turned and grinned at her. "I do love to see you blush ... it's been a
while. I wanted to apologize for my ... inattention," he said with a
slight roll of his eyes. "Do you ever question your Impression to Camilth?"

"Ew." She poked him. "Burp the other way. You're almost as bad as Camilth."
Paetri smiled and shrugged. "It's okay. I've been keeping busy and..." Her
voice trailed off and her brows shot up at the sudden change of subject.
"What?" She frowned and tugged at her braid. "No. Not really. I mean, I
used to because I didn't think I could do certain things, but I really
don't think about that any more." She tilted her head. "Why? Did something
happen?"

That familiar tug calmed him a bit and he sighed, dropping his head back
against the couch. "Rademerth won Petrith's flight and I realized just how
much she's sucked me in, how I've lost myself. J'kri ... oh shells ... I
hurt him. All this time."

Her brows rose and she silently congratulated Rademerth for winning
Petrith's flight; he'd been so upset when he'd lost Camilth's. But then
her brows snapped down and her voice immediately gentled as she laid a
light hand on her arm. "It can get better, D'ret."

Blinking teary eyes, D'ret looked at her. "How? He's been seeing others,
hasn't he? I mean ... that was part of the point of my being distant. He
has to know all the possibilities, right?" This was all new to him,
relationships. What the shells was he thinking getting involved with
someone at the Weyr?

She flushed a little and looked down at her lap. "Well...yes. I'm one of
them, D'ret." She took a breath and looked up at him. "We've been spending
a lot of time together." She lifted her hands and gently wiped at his eyes
with her thumbs. "What do you want, D'ret? In your heart, what do you want?"

A strange little smile appeared at her confession as he processed her
words. Was he upset they were together? No, which was a relief. It was
kind of ... intriguing. "What do I want? Shells and shards, who has time
to think of that?" he asked then chuckled and kissed her palm. "I want
J'kri's love and for him to be happy. Whether it's with me or ... others.
I just don't know if I deserve it."

She looked at him for a moment, tilted her head, took a breath and then
calmly whacked him in the back of the head with her palm. "That's for
saying you don't deserve it." She pointed a finger at him. "You could make
him happy too, you know. You wouldn't let me doubt me, so I'm not letting
you doubt you. He wouldn't be happy with just a woman, just like he
wouldn't be happy with just a man. So...." Her brow knit a little bit more.
"why don't you be that man that he needs?"

"Oww!" The slap was a surprise but it snapped him out of his self-pity.
"The man? Do you know who you're talking to? Okay ... okay!" he said
leaning away to avoid another slap. "I think we can work on that. Are ...
will you be okay with it?"

Putting her hand down from its threatening position, she leaned back
against the couch. "I'll tell you the same thing I told him when he asked
me. It's part of who he is. I can't just pick and choose parts of him. He
likes men..." She eyed him. "...male greenriders just as much as women.
And you're my friend too, D'ret. I'd want to see you both happy."

"Where did the scared little girl go that first came here?" D'ret asked
with a soft smile. He was in awe of how much she'd changed. "J'kri's a
good influence. And you are amazing, Paetri. Shall we gang up on him and
talk things out?"

"Still here. She's just growing up." At his compliment, she reddened just a
touch. J'kri had said much the same to her over the past few weeks.

She thought about his suggestion and tugged on her braid. She didn't think
J'kri would be expecting it, but then again, he hadn't expected her to come
to him half naked the first time either and it had worked out well. "When
will you be ready for that?"

"That part isn't up to me. I'm ready anytime," he said with his usual
wicked little grin. "But I don't think we should wait too long. J'kri
will be thrilled with this idea, I'm sure of it."

"He'll be shocked." She replied dryly. Then, when he recovers, he might be
thrilled." She tugged on her braid as she rose. "Come on then, let's ambush
him."

"Now?" D'ret asked a bit shocked himself and looked at her with eyebrows
raised. He was beginning to think the pair had spent a bit more time
together than he realized. "All right, let's go."

Paetri shrugged. "If I actually sit and think about it, I'll change my
mind." She grabbed his arm and tugged him to his feet. "Besides, I'm going
to let you do most of the talking."
